Welcome to Itsukushima Shrine, one of the most famous tourist attractions not only in Hiroshima but in Japan. The shrine complex is most famous for its dramatic torii gate built in water which appears to float during high tide. This is the time when this place is most picturesque. Pilgrims can access the gate during low tide. It was rebuilt 8 times since 1168 and the current one was completed in 1875. One of the most recognized landmarks in Horoshima is Peace Memorial Park commemorating the victims of the world’s first nuclear attack. In this green island situated in the middle of the city you can find there not only the Children’s Peace Monument but also Hiroshima Atomic Bomb dome. Situated close to the hypocenter of the nuclear bomb, it remained standing, and it has been left intact since then. For car enthusiasts there is Mazda Museum. You can admire present as well as past models of this car manufacturer based in Hiroshima. In Yamato museum you can see 1:10 scale replica of the battleship ‘Yamato’ as well as a real Mitsubishi Zero A6M fighter plane.
Hiroshima gardens attract thousands of visitors especially in spring and autumn. We recommend Shukkeien Garden which is the oldest Japanese Garden in the city and 5000 square-meters Hill of Hope Garden built of white marble that was excavated from a quarry in Carrara, Italy.
